For science fiction or fantasy fans: The Search for Wandla by Tony Diterlizzi

Recommendation written by Isabella Dunkley This exciting sci-fi/fantasy is great for ages 12+. I've read it twice and I own the rest of this trilogy. It's about a girl named Eva Nine who journeys across Orbona looking for other humans on this strange alien-infested Earth.
